1 CORINTHIANS 13:4
“Love suffers long and is kind; love does not envy; love does not parade itself, is not puffed up;”
I Corinthians 13:4 NKJV
https://bible.com/bible/114/1co.13.4.NKJ
This verse defines biblical love (agape) as an active, selfless choice rather than a mere feeling. Written by the Apostle Paul, this verse contrasts self-centered behavior with outward kindness, showing that true love requires profound patience and the intentional setting aside of pride and jealousy.
Love exercises restraint and endures difficult situations or offenses without resentment or the urge to retaliate.
It is actively helpful, gentle, and benevolent, looking to benefit others even when it does not serve one's own interests.
It removes jealousy over what others possess and instead rejoices in their successes.
It abstains from self-promotion, arrogance, and drawing attention to one's own accomplishments.
It is humble, treating others with consistent dignity rather than a feeling of superiority.
Understanding these descriptors helps believers and anyone in relationships, shifting the focus away from what they feel they are "owed" and move toward active service and unselfish devotion.
Love is the foundation of Jesus way of life. He said, “”You shall love the LordLord your God with all your heart, with all your soul, and with all your mind.’ This is thethe first and great commandment. And thethe second isis like it: ‘You shall love your neighbor as yourself.’ On these two commandments hang all the Law and the Prophets.””
Matthew 22:37-40 NKJV
This refers to the entire body of Jewish scripture—the Torah (the first five books of the Old Testament containing God's laws) and the writings of the prophets.
“Hang on these two". Jesus used this phrase to mean that all the specific rules, regulations, and moral teachings in the scriptures take their meaning from these two principles. If you perfectly practice love for God and love for your fellow human, you fulfill the entire purpose of the law.
